Youngblood, Travis Levy
On July 21, 2005, the NAVY lost PO3 Youngblood, Travis Levy of SURRENCY, GA in BAGHDAD, IRAQ. He was 26. Cause: HOSTILE.

Operation Iraqi Freedom began March 19, 2003 with the US-led invasion. The stated justification ? weapons of mass destruction ? was never found. Seven years of occupation, insurgency, and sectarian war followed, killing 4,418 Americans and an estimated 200,000 Iraqi civilians.
